摘要 <p>The present invention relates to conversion of exhaust gas containing nitrogen oxide (NOx) such as NO, NO2 and N2O into N2 and H2O through catalytic reaction with injection of a reducing agent such as ammonia and urea. A fabrication method of zeolite honeycomb type catalyst for reducing nitrogen oxide of the present invention includes: (a) obtaining an inorganic binder by mixing and uniformly peptizing pseudo-boehmite, distilled water and a pH adjuster; (b) obtaining a paste by mixing and kneading zeolite, the inorganic binder, an organic binder and distilled water; (c) extruding the paste into an extrudate having a through pore of a regular structure; and (d) drying and heat treating the extrudate.</p>
